By the way there shouldn't be issue rebooting download mode, try this
Connect device to PC
Keep holding vol down + power - As soon as device screen turns off (reboot), release power and hold Vol up +down
This should reboot device to download mode
Remember you needs to connect to PC during this. Sometimes perfect timing is needed, keep trying and you should have download mode, once you have straightway flash stock rom and use Csc*.tar.md5 instead home_csc*

Since we now have TWRP with data encryption support, What you prefer to have ROM with Encrypted/Decrypted data?
Benefits :
- With data encryption your data will remain safe
- Won't require to Format data while moving between Stock/Custom ROM (Encrypted data supported)
Bugs :
In both the cases System will remain System-RW (read/write capabilities)
- TWRP have still one bug, If you set LockScreen Password, TWRP can't decrypt it. So you have to disable Password in case you want to use TWRP with Internal Storage Access
- May be Encrypted related any bug, We needs to test more but Primarily seems no any issue
I have added poll to OP, Kindly vote, If there are enough users to test Encrypted then I may make Two version of ROM for T06.
T07 will have data Encrypted/Decrypted depend on what majority of users choose.
